Longevity and Toughness



When examining roofing materials, the long life and resilience of slate stand out as essential benefits. Slate roof is renowned for its outstanding lifespan, commonly lasting over a century if effectively kept. This remarkable longevity is mostly because of the all-natural stone's resistance to ecological aspects such as severe climate condition, UV radiation, and fire. Unlike various other roof covering products that might wear away or need frequent replacement, slate's durable nature ensures it continues to be undamaged and practical for generations.


In addition, slate's toughness is unequaled. The product is exceptionally thick and has a low tide absorption rate, which decreases the threat of frost damages and freeze-thaw cycles that can pester various other roof types. This resilience encompasses its resistance against mold, mold, and insect problems, additionally decreasing maintenance demands and expenses over time.






In addition, slate roofs are very immune to breakage and impact damages, making them an optimal selection for areas vulnerable to severe climate events, such as hailstorms. The mix of longevity and resilience not only provides substantial expense financial savings in the future but additionally adds to sustainability by reducing the frequency of roofing replacements and the associated waste.

Cost Factors To Consider



Cost factors to consider are a vital aspect when examining slate roofing, as it is among the most costly roof materials readily available. The initial important site financial investment for slate roof covering can be substantial, with costs ranging from $15 to $30 per square foot for products alone. When factoring in the intricacy of Our site the roofing layout and the expertise needed for appropriate setup., this price can intensify additionally.

Furthermore, the weight of slate ceramic tiles requires strengthened architectural assistance, which can contribute to both material and labor costs. Homeowners need to usually engage architectural engineers to assess and perhaps improve their roof covering framework to birth the extra weight. This additional action sustains more monetary investment but is crucial for guaranteeing the longevity and security of the installment.

Installation Process



The setup process for slate roofing demands precise focus to detail and customized experience. Unlike other roof products, slate is both heavy and breakable, calling for precision handling and a very carefully structured installation approach. The roof covering framework need to be evaluated to ensure it can sustain the substantial weight of slate ceramic tiles, which can be four times larger than asphalt roof shingles.


After verifying structural integrity, a water-proof underlayment is mounted to provide an extra layer of defense against dampness infiltration. Next, the specific slate ceramic tiles are thoroughly set out in a staggered pattern, starting at the roofing's side and proceeding upward. Each tile is very carefully aligned and secured with copper or stainless-steel nails, making sure long-lasting longevity and resilience against harsh climate problems.


In addition, the cutting and fitting of slate tiles around roofing system penetrations, such as vents and smokeshafts, need high skill and accuracy. When carried out correctly, slate roof uses unmatched elegance and longevity, warranting the investment in seasoned experts.
